Some detail about Ellen Page’s involvement with Beyond from the creator
Cage is not a marketing guy, but he is a great salesman. Before we see the footage for the first time, he milks the announcement of Ellen Page as his star with gusto, reducing his soft voice almost to a whisper and offering a dramatic pause before her name. She was who he’d had in mind from the moment he started writing Jodie, he says, for her combination of strength and vulnerability. He describes her arriving at their first meeting like a soft-focus scene in a romantic movie.
“When she came she was 10 metres away, looking for some strange French people somewhere, and when I saw her I felt, my God, that’s Jodie. It’s a very strange thing for a writer, seeing your character appear in front of you by magic, almost. As she was walking towards me, it lasted like 10 seconds, but it was a year for me.” Cue strings.
I’m kidding, but in conversation later, Cage swells with genuine, starstruck pride about working with Page. “She came in a very simple way… very easy to deal with, very professional, just wanting to give her best. She really respected the medium, which was something incredibly important to me, to have someone saying, ‘I’m going to treat that as seriously as if it was a movie, I don’t care it was a game.’
“When you direct someone like Ellen it’s really like driving a Ferrari… It’s really sensitive. You need to be very careful about what you say because she’s going to give it to you.” He’s full of praise for her work ethic too - and it was work, as different as you can get from an easy voiceover gig. Shooting without sets, props or costumes on Quantic’s motion capture stage in Paris “requires a lot of concentration and focus” from an actor, Cage reckons. “She kept saying that this is like an acting boot camp.” Has she seen the results yet? “No… not yet,” he says a little sheepishly. “But I think she will be surprised!”
